Q1medium

A copper wire of cross-sectional area 1.0×106,m21.0 \times 10^{-6},\text{m}^2 carries a current of 2.0,A2.0,\text{A}. If the number density of free electrons in copper is 8.5×1028,m38.5 \times 10^{28},\text{m}^{-3}, what is the drift velocity of the electrons? (Charge of electron e=1.6×1019,Ce = 1.6 \times 10^{-19},\text{C})

Q3easy

A current of 1.6,A1.6,\text{A} flows through a conductor. If the number of free electrons per unit volume is 1029,m310^{29},\text{m}^{-3} and the cross-sectional area of the conductor is 1.0×105,m21.0 \times 10^{-5},\text{m}^2, what is the drift velocity of the electrons? (Charge of electron e=1.6×1019,Ce = 1.6 \times 10^{-19},\text{C})

Q5medium

Two wires, A and B, are made of the same material and have the same length. Wire A has a radius rr, and wire B has a radius 2r2r. If the same current flows through both wires, what is the ratio of the drift velocity in wire A to that in wire B (vdA:vdBv_{dA} : v_{dB})?
